AI Summary

  • Requires all individual and group health insurance policies, service contracts, and managed care entities issued or renewed on or after July 1, 2015, to provide coverage for treatment of autism spectrum disorders that is at least as comprehensive as coverage for other neurological disorders.

  • Coverage must be provided to persons younger than 27 years of age and subject to deductible, copayment, and annual limitation requirements no more stringent than those applied to other neurological disorders.

  • Prohibits insurers from refusing to renew policies, reissuing policies, or terminating services to individuals solely because they are diagnosed with an autism spectrum disorder.

  • Excludes accident-only, specified disease, hospital indemnity, Medicare supplement, long-term care, and other limited benefit hospital insurance policies from coverage requirements.

  • Effective date is January 1, 2015, with provisions applying to contracts, policies, or plans delivered, issued, amended, or renewed on or after that date.
